Frequently Asked Questions about the 89199 ZIP Code
How much are Studio apartments in 89199?
There are currently 292 Studio Apartments in 89199 with rent ranges from $879 to $2,950 with an average price of $1,258.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om 89199 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 89199 ranges from $500 to $4,020 with an average monthly rent of $1,848.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 89199 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 89199 range from $635 to $5,249.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,096.
How expensive are 89199 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 81 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 89199 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$775 to $7,590 - averaging $1,998 for the location.
